从原来的AMP更快:AMP + SSR =⚡ 发布时间:2019年9月26日下午10时29 PDT <原创博客是 在这里 可以在博客上找到并翻译评审的参与给了乔(WEBTECH GDE)> AMP正式被认为可以应用到当前页面的AMP安普页面可以更快地加载在服务器端渲染(SSR)技术的支持。我们的测试结果,著名的 FCP指标 显示在高达50%的速度大幅增加。谷歌AMP缓存已经来到采取这种技术一会儿的优势,但现在开发者可以在自己的域名使用此技术!如果您使用AMP提供关键环境的网站,额外的优化程序的安装就显得尤为重要。即使是AMP页面的运行和“配对AMP设置“非AMP的网页,用户使用这种技术时,不使用AMP缓存,如使用Twitter的应用程序,以确保用户获得最佳性能你可以。 SSR 是用于提高FCP(第一contentful漆)时为客户端框架呈现页面,如反应或Vue.js.的技术客户端呈现的缺点是,你必须下载页面上的所有必要的JavaScript,第一次呈现。所以,直到用户浏览网页的实际内容将被推迟。为了缓解这一问题,反应,并根据要求呈现给DOM提前两个搜索服务器Vue.js支持。然后,在客户端JavaScript拿起渲染,这是(重新)水合的过程。其结果是,用户将能够更快地查看内容。 AMP SSR是 AMP样板代码 的工作原理是去除和渲染来自服务器的页面布局。的AMP样板代码存在的目的是为了防止内容跳转页面加载时。此代码隐藏页面内容,直到AMP架构将被下载和页面布局成立。因此,直到你下载了同样的问题,即JavaScript和其他客户端框架AMP页面已经经历渲染块的问题。如果删除AMP SSR的锅炉板代码 的FCP时间快50% 。 以下是对SSR版本AMP文件,该文件是如何不同(进行了详细的描述比较 官方指南 参考)。 通过在html元素的变换属性可以通过在服务器端的AMP页面渲染识别。 <HTML安培转化= “自我; V = 1”> 注:AMP缓存是建立自己的标志,例如,在谷歌AMP缓存添加以下内容: <HTML安培转化= “谷歌; V = 1”> ...